Output 3666c9713cab58e794caeafb4bbd09b4d54d12a4b5aa25052c496bdb5f920804:9

value
51725503
script pubkey
OP_0 OP_PUSHBYTES_20 b4af457a20e77829fc51748fd9bd55b46fafa049
address
ltc1qkjh5273quauznlz3wj8an024k3h6lgzf0y04mc
transaction
3666c9713cab58e794caeafb4bbd09b4d54d12a4b5aa25052c496bdb5f920804
spent
true